The All Progressives Congress (APC) spokesperson in Lagos, Joe Igbokwe, has said the governorship primaries was postponed until Monday because people have to go to church on Sunday.

“People have to be in church on Sunday, so we have rescheduled until Monday unfailingly.

“There are other issues around logistics, but everything would be done by Monday,” Igbokwe told Premium Times.

The APC on Saturday postponed the governorship primaries for Lagos and Imo States.

The announcement comes amid stiff contest for the ruling party’s governor ticket between incumbent Governor, Akinwunmi Ambode and Jide Sanwo-Olu.

Sanwo-Olu reportedly received the endorsement of 36 out of the state’s 40 lawmakers on Sunday afternoon, while another governorship aspirant and challenger, Babatunde Hamzat, stepped down for him.
